A concise yet technically authoritative overview of modern marine
energy devices with the goal of sustainable electricity generation
With 165 full-colour illustrations and photographs of devices at an
advanced stage, the book provides inspiring case studies of today s
most promising marine energy devices and developments, including
full-scale grid-connected prototypes tested in sea conditions. It
also covers the European Marine Energy Centre (EMEC) in Orkney,
Scotland, where many of the devices are assessed. Topics discussed:
* global resources drawing energy from the World s waves and tides
* history of wave and tidal stream systems * theoretical background
to modern developments * conversion of marine energy into grid
electricity * modern wave energy converters and tidal stream energy
converters This book is aimed at a wide readership including
professionals, policy makers and employees in the energy sector
needing an introduction to marine energy. Its descriptive style and
technical level will also appeal to students of renewable energy,
and the growing number of people who wish to understand how marine
devices can contribute to carbon-free electricity generation in the
21st century.
